Skye narrowed her eyes but didn’t stop. Let them watch.

The VIP corridor was a different world. The chaotic noise of the main floor was muffled by heavy soundproofing, replaced by a hush that cost five thousand dollars a bottle to experience. Skye walked down the hallway, the plush red carpet swallowing the sound of her heels. She counted the doors.

One. Two. Three.

Room 4.

She didn’t knock.

Skye pushed the heavy door open. The room was dimly lit by amber sconces, smelling of leather and decadence. Ethan Vance was lounging on a velvet sofa that looked like it had been upholstered in sin. He was surrounded by three women—models, by the look of their impossible bone structure—who were laughing at a joke he probably hadn’t even finished telling.

Ethan looked up. His glass of whiskey paused halfway to his mouth. The lazy, predatory grin he wore for the models vanished, replaced by genuine confusion that quickly sharpened into recognition.

“Well,” Ethan drawled, setting his glass down. He waved a dismissive hand at the women. “Ladies, the fun police have arrived. Scram p>

The models pouted, gathering their clutches and casting dirty looks at Skye as they filed out. Skye ignored them. She waited until the last one had left, then let the heavy door click shut. The silence that followed was heavy, pressurized.

“You look better,” Ethan said, leaning back and spreading his arms along the top of the sofa. “Less like a corpse, more like a vampire. I like it p>

Skye didn’t sit. She walked to the small bar cart in the corner. She didn’t pour a drink. Instead, she picked up the crystal decanter, feeling its weight, and turned to face him.

“You have a big mouth, Vance,” she said softly.

Ethan chuckled. “Is this about the lecture hall? Your husband looked like he was going to pop a vein. I was just being a concerned citizen p>

“You were marking territory,” Skye corrected.

She walked toward him, stopping only when her knees brushed the coffee table. She sat with deliberate control, making the shift in power unmistakable. “But right now, I’m not here to argue about your ego. I’m here to save your neck p>

Ethan’s smile faltered. He sat up straighter, reaching for his drink. “What are you talking about p>

“I’m talking about your sloppiness,” Skye said.

She pulled her phone from her pocket and tapped the screen once. Then she turned it around and placed it face-up on the table. It was a spreadsheet. A very specific spreadsheet.

Ethan squinted at the small screen. Then he froze. His hand tightened around his whiskey glass until his knuckles turned white.

“The Cayman Islands,” Skye said conversationally. “Account number 774-Bravo. It’s amazing how much money flows through shell companies registered to your ‘consulting firm,’ isn’t it? I found the printouts in Liam’s wastebasket last week. He thought they were trash. I thought they were leverage p>

Ethan stared at her. The playboy was gone. In his place was the scion of a ruthless business empire. His eyes were cold, calculating.
